The Uplifting Sound of Contemporary Gospel: A Fusion of Faith and Modern Music
Contemporary gospel is a dynamic genre that blends the rich traditions of gospel music with the contemporary sounds of R&B, pop, and rock. Known for its soulful vocals, uplifting lyrics, and infectious rhythms, contemporary gospel music continues to inspire listeners around the world. It offers a fresh and vibrant approach to worship and spirituality, while maintaining the deeply-rooted messages of faith and hope that define gospel music.
At the core of contemporary gospel are some of the most influential and beloved artists in the genre. Kirk Franklin, Tasha Cobbs Leonard, Tamela Mann, Hezekiah Walker, and Yolanda Adams are just a few of the names that have shaped the sound of modern gospel music. These artists have found ways to blend the passion and spirit of traditional gospel with contemporary elements, creating a sound that resonates with a wide audience. Their music delivers not only powerful vocals but also messages of joy, faith, and perseverance in the face of life's challenges.

The roots of contemporary gospel music trace back to the African-American church in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Traditional gospel music was known for its call-and-response singing, complex harmonies, and the powerful vocals that conveyed deep emotion and faith. Over time, contemporary gospel music evolved by incorporating elements from R&B, pop, and rock, making it more accessible to a broader audience while still maintaining the genre’s core messages of hope, joy, and spiritual growth.
Today, contemporary gospel has a broad and diverse following, with listeners from all walks of life who are drawn to its positive messages and passionate performances. It resonates with those seeking music that speaks to the human spirit, celebrates resilience, and affirms faith. The genre has found a place in both church settings and the mainstream music scene, continuing to inspire new generations of gospel music lovers.
